Consent

Overview

Participation in this research session is entirely voluntary. You can refuse to answer any questions or withdraw at any stage. The researcher may also decide to stop the session at any time. This will not affect your anonymity or any incentive that has been offered. 

Information we want to collect

We need your comments and feedback to help make HMRC services better. To help us analyse and share our findings, we take notes in every session and people from the project team will be observing. 

We may record video and audio of you, record the screen, take photographs during the session, these will be used by the project team for analysis. HMRC will not be able to provide copies of the recording or transcripts as they contain confidential HMRC information. 

How we ensure your privacy and treat data

Only people from the project team will be observing the session and they may watch the recordings and read the transcripts in the future. We use your feedback in reports to share our findings within HMRC and the wider government but your data will be anonymous. 

We may include video, audio clips, photographs or transcripts when sharing feedback with people inside HMRC and wider government to improve our services. They will not be shared outside the government.
